Output fbabe78060a7faa29526b2aa2914d56de67000d228a0380565c77daa478e7083:1

value
1437246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a5f66cb839c6e6bf0c5d5fc8886151a7546c5e2 OP_EQUAL
address
3FmGGhcZy24BC2pwfeX92vM9RPc1mS2Vm7
transaction
fbabe78060a7faa29526b2aa2914d56de67000d228a0380565c77daa478e7083
spent
true